Terribly Good Cinema presents: But I’m a Cheerleader
Homophonic2019-14.jpg
“ ✰✰✰✰✰ This film is hilarious. A brilliant critique of the idea that you can ‘cure’ someone of their sexuality” - Amazon

Megan Bloomfield (Natasha Lyonne) has it all. She’s a blonde high-school cheerleader who gets good grades and is dating a footballer. Megan doesn’t realise she is a lesbian. Her friends and family do, and after an awkward intervention Megan is sent to True Directions, a gay conversion centre, to undergo a five-step program to cure her gayness. Here she meets Graham (Clea Duvall) and romance blooms amongst the bigotry.

A cult classic of queer cinema, But I’m a Cheerleader explodes on the big screen in a burst of bright colour and campy fun. Suitable for tweens and teens, this black comedy takes a lighter look at gender roles, conversion therapy and young lesbian romance.

Duration: 92 minutes

Rating: M, Film contains mild language and sexual themes

Director: Jamie Babbit Writer: Brian Wayne Peterson

Cast: Nathasha Lyonne, Clea Duvall, Melanie Lynskey, RuPaul Charles
